$1411
lotofacil 26 12 23,A Hostess Bonita Compete ao Vivo Online, Oferecendo Comentários em Tempo Real Que Capturam Toda a Emoção e Intensidade dos Jogos Populares..Os métodos mais importantes na implementação são o corrigeSubindo e o corrigeDescendo. O primeiro corrige o heap para um determinado índice recém-adicionado. É utilizado na inserção, pois para inserir um elemento em um heap podemos simplesmente adicioná-lo no final do arranjo, e depois empurrá-lo para cima na árvore enquanto ele for menor que o pai (ou maior, se for um heap de máximo). Já o corrigeDescendo realiza o mesmo processo, mas é utilizado quando o elemento precisa ser empurrado para baixo, e não para cima. Isso acontece na remoção, pois nesta operação selecionamos o último elemento do arranjo e trocamos com a raiz. Assim, podemos descartar a raiz (que está no final do arranjo agora, bastando remover o último elemento do arranjo). Porém, o último elemento do arranjo (que foi movido para a raiz) provavelmente não é o menor, e a raiz deve sempre guardar o menor elemento. Portanto, devemos empurrar o elemento para baixo até que o heap esteja corrigido. Segue uma implementação recursiva dessas duas funções:,Os lombardos saíram de Mauringa e chegaram a Golanda. O acadêmico Ludwig Schmidt acredita que esta região ficaria ainda mais a leste, talvez na margem direita do rio Oder. Schmidt considera que o nome seria um equivalente de Gotlândia, significando apenas "boa terra". Esta teoria é muito plausível; Paulo, o Diácono menciona um episódio no qual os lombardos teriam cruzado um rio, chegando à ''Rugilândia'' vindos da região do alto Oder através da Porta Morávia..
lotofacil 26 12 23,A Hostess Bonita Compete ao Vivo Online, Oferecendo Comentários em Tempo Real Que Capturam Toda a Emoção e Intensidade dos Jogos Populares..Os métodos mais importantes na implementação são o corrigeSubindo e o corrigeDescendo. O primeiro corrige o heap para um determinado índice recém-adicionado. É utilizado na inserção, pois para inserir um elemento em um heap podemos simplesmente adicioná-lo no final do arranjo, e depois empurrá-lo para cima na árvore enquanto ele for menor que o pai (ou maior, se for um heap de máximo). Já o corrigeDescendo realiza o mesmo processo, mas é utilizado quando o elemento precisa ser empurrado para baixo, e não para cima. Isso acontece na remoção, pois nesta operação selecionamos o último elemento do arranjo e trocamos com a raiz. Assim, podemos descartar a raiz (que está no final do arranjo agora, bastando remover o último elemento do arranjo). Porém, o último elemento do arranjo (que foi movido para a raiz) provavelmente não é o menor, e a raiz deve sempre guardar o menor elemento. Portanto, devemos empurrar o elemento para baixo até que o heap esteja corrigido. Segue uma implementação recursiva dessas duas funções:,Os lombardos saíram de Mauringa e chegaram a Golanda. O acadêmico Ludwig Schmidt acredita que esta região ficaria ainda mais a leste, talvez na margem direita do rio Oder. Schmidt considera que o nome seria um equivalente de Gotlândia, significando apenas "boa terra". Esta teoria é muito plausível; Paulo, o Diácono menciona um episódio no qual os lombardos teriam cruzado um rio, chegando à ''Rugilândia'' vindos da região do alto Oder através da Porta Morávia..